The Pentagon has recently announced that the United States will be reducing its troop presence in Syria by nearly half in the coming months. This decision has been confirmed by top officials and is seen as a significant step towards the eventual withdrawal of American forces from the war-torn country.
For years, the United States has maintained a military presence in Syria, with the primary goal of defeating the Islamic State (IS) terrorist group. However, with the recent success of the US-led coalition in pushing back IS, the need for such a large number of troops on the ground has diminished.
According to the Pentagon, the current number of troops in Syria stands at around 2,000. This number will be reduced to less than 1,000 in the coming months, marking a significant decrease in the US military presence in the region.
